OBJECT : "Home-Made Controls" Problems in Sizu V268 As many developers I create my own controls derived from simpler ones ; I use currently 2 of them for management of special definitions of Dates and Times Values like Years Going from -99999 to +999999 idem for hours , minutes , seconds etc ...this require a huge fonctions library behind which I developped and use in my Form/Dialog Boxes ..... BUT they are not standard , so not recognized automatically by Sizuliser : They appear with the message "Click to Analyse" ...SO I DID : gave a "standard" control name and 99 % of the other controls DISAPPEARED from the screen .....the "nonstandard" control seeming to cover the entire form/dialog box and beeing NOT modificable ... ALSO when checking/validating(?) for "errors" the concerned control is not found in the list in the bottom window , only the other home-made control is , the one NOT touch YET ; The one ALREADY touched and creating the current problem does not appear in the list . HOW to get ALL BACK in right order ???? I had the idea to look at the list/text of controls from editor option , all controls seem to be STILL THERE , so I wanted to modify the "new" screen/list taking the model of "original" screen/list in a Compare option... BUT the lists are READ ONLY ...and there is no option to copy/paste from one list to the other . Could that SOLVE the "disappearing Pb" ? Could we modify the content ALSO by Save/Load a GOOD control (s) from already saved CONTROL/FILE ????? (=>Wish List if not done yet) CONNECTED to that aspect it would be USEFULL (would shorten work for complicated /Heavy hand work problems) to GENERATE DIRECTLY the DFM Files (BCBUILDER ++V5), should not be too difficult having already the complete , decribed , list of controls in read only aspect . (=>Wish List if not done yet) I am adding an other "standard" control Pb : TStatusBar , they have panels where text is shown ...and modificable by Sizulizer But they seem completely unaccesible in SIZE/POSITION ....??? Hello Jean Christian, If you use custom mapping (click to map), and you would like change mapping or remove mapping, you should go to menu Project > Components… and after open Components dialog window, you will see list of all your custom (added) components. Here you could change mapping of our control (double click on component name or Edit button in toolbar), add your control to Global settings by Publish button (component will be available for all your projects), remove or export it. If position, sizes or text of your custom control aren’t modifiable, you should select component on list and edit it (double click or Edit button). You will see dialog window with 3 tabs, in first you could change mapping, in third tab (Options) you could enable or disable some properties of control. For example, if you will check “Exclude the whole component and it's properties”, you couldn’t to modify strings, sizes an position of control, if you will check “Exclude all string properties by default”, you couldn’t to modify strings properties. If above advices aren’t useful for you, because you couldn’t match your custom control to existing mappings, and if you have source code of your control you could add source code of your control directly to project. As I mentioned in my answer on your post in forum topic http://forum.sisulizer.com/forum4/84.html improving of mapping mechanism is “never ending story” and our R&D continuously working on this, so if adding source code to project also doesn’t work, you could send to us your files with binary file having the home made control. Maybe our R&D will find some solution, but we need your files. If your controls aren’t your home made controls and are third party components, we could to add support to these controls, but we need access to controls source, information about developer of control etc. During developing of the Sisulizer our R&D added support for dozens third party components. Here latest example: http://forum.sisulizer.com/forum7/1001.html. You can find list of supported VCL controls here: menu Tools > Platforms > VCL, for .NET here: menu Tools > Platforms > .NET.
